Camille

Camille is an excellent pick as a bruiser champ,and she also has a lot of tools in her kit that help her in several ways. She has a self heal, a stun, a boost of movement speed on her Q, an attack speed boost on her stun ability, and a lock in ability like Jarvan where she marks a specific champion inside a specific place for a good amount of time. The reason she is top tier is because she is extremely strong in her laning phase compared to before and the new runes in season have worked out extremely well for her making her probably the best bruiser in the game with good splitpushing power and teamfight potential. She is able to gain leads extremely easily in lane if played right and gives very small opening for the enemy to act on. Comet allows her to poke constantly for a great deal of damage in lane while also providing sustain and other abilities maintain her strong prowess.

Sion

Sion is in a good spot right now for the same reason as Camille, he is able to poke endlessly and harrass and deal a good amount of damage and his tankiness makes it very hard to die and very forgiving in terms of mispositioning. Although, sometimes dying is recommended as this champion’s passive turns him into a horror zombie after death that deals a good chunk of damage as it runs towards the enemy with high amount of speed often forcing the enemy’s summoner spells like Flash or Heal to survive Sion’s incoming slaughter. He too has extremely good synergy with Comet, and thus deals an astonishing amount of damage early into the game. His abilities bring a lot of CC, and help a lot in teamfights helping him synergize with champions like Nami which can land follow up Crowd Control on the enemy with ease.

Morderkaiser

Mordekaiser has received a good amount of help indirectly through changes to the items to AP champions.It has definitely helped out Mordekaiser in a big way in recent patches and made him a strong champion in the lower elos, he has a good bit of everything in his kit, a heal, harrass/poke ability, a shield, a situational speed boost, and the ability to take away good chunks of his enemy’s health if allowed to. He is also this champion that’s really simple and very oppressive combined with Rune Keystones like Aery, if you dedicate some time in learning him and the way he rotates inside the game and around the map based on controlling objectives such as Dragons which on killing grant him his own pet dragon to travel with him is a huge perk. Learning how to properly build him, and then learn how to play out and bully some of his matchups is also a needed skill when you play in the toplane, he is going to be a champion that will probably get you a lot of wins because of his rarity and people just dont expect the amount of impact he can do and his damage or his heal.

Yorick

The new sterak’s is doing amazing for him, it’s amazing for a lot of bruisers actually but it still works with trinity force which is a standard in his build that gives him some burst and give him some defense. It’s not increasing the damage on activation of sheen anymore but it still increases your damage. The buff he got to his Q must have helped this as well, his Q can now be used more often so he’s going to be healing for more, getting more sheen procs and more damage output. It’s kind of weird though, since such a small change could have given him such a boost in charts. From barely in the top 30 over in Korea in the top lane champions and now he’s going to be top 2. Yorick’s early game power has always been really good and now his mid game and late game has tuned to be better. Yorick can be a monster champion and the best part about this is if it works at higher ranks in Korea, then it 100% runs well at even lower ranks making him even better. Poppy

Most people in Korea run a very damage-heavy version in the runes with Aery which lets her poke with her passive as often as possible and also her Q. Using her right now is sort of a bruiser counter, there are a lot of matchups where she can match the damage and sustain with bruisers right now. Riot has this new obsession with giving toplaners a lot of mobility, which poppy can counter with her W, rendering any dashes useless. Fiora, Camille, Jax, Renekton are really good examples of champions that Poppy can stop and make them a lot weaker just because they cannot jump around. Even though, Poppy is a tank, she still follows the same curve of winning earlier  into the game mostly because she can shut down most of these guys in the laning phase. Having a tank ready as some engage and a frontline is really good for soloqueue at the moment if you can contain a carry pick in lane and not get put behind which is exactly what poppy does.

Karma

Karma is a niche and unpopular pick in the toplane. Mainly because she is built and played in a playstyle different to what she is supposed to be played like, which is an AP mage or support and rather played as a tank with huge amount of mana and likes to abuse her base power and cooldowns on AD champions in the top lane as a counterpick which has increased since the introduction of Conqueror for AD bruisers. She uses the new manaflow band extremely well. Her Mantra + Q combo is her main poke ability and deals a ton of damage. She has a good advantage because most top laners are melee so she can abuse the fact that she is ranged. She does an insane amount of damage early into the game. She has a tetherred ability to setup kills and ganks by stunning them which is very crucial in toplane being the easiest gankable lane and preferred to be ganked by junglers. And since games are getting over pretty quickly, you aren’t running over scaling issues with her and can maintain your lead without worrying of becoming useless as game progresses since you should be able to close the game with a nice team.
